Leona Lewis, Spirit
I love, love, love this CD! I couldn’t get enough of it in the car and her voice is just remarkable. Her version of Roberta Flack’s The First Time Ever I Saw Your Face is beautiful. She is more known for Bleeding Love and I Will Be, but all the songs on this CD are well worth listening to! ($8.99)
Natasha Bedingfield, Pocketful of Sunshine
When I first heard her sing Soulmate on the latest season of The Bachelorette, I was hypnotized. Of course, her title track is a hit, especially with the tweens out there! I can remember mine rockin’ out to it at the Sushi bar! She has a beautiful voice… really.
Adele, 19
Chasing Pavements is a song that I NEVER get sick of! Her voice is smoky and smooth. Love her!
Aretha Franklin, This Christmas
O.K., so it’s not released YET. But, anything that Aretha sings is like silk wrapped in lush, rich melody. And, if you’re not the “Christmas Music” type… get some vintage Aretha and listen while you clean house…. R.E.S.P.E.C.T. I recommend The Best of Aretha Franklin… downloaded it off iTunes… yummy!
Rascal Flatts, Greatest Hits Volume 1
You get My Wish, Bless the Broken Road and Life Is A Highway all in on album! Can’t go wrong with this one, EVER!
The Pointer Sisters, The Best of the Pointer Sisters
All I can say about this one is that this is all YASMIN’s FAULT! If you’re a child of the 70′s… GET IT! Do the Neutron Dance!
Glen Campbell, Meet Glen Campbell
I heard him on Mark & Brian (KLOS 95.5) and couldn’t get over the still heart-warming voice! This album is him doing covers of all kinds of different songs including Times Like These and All I Want is You. It’s very good! Trust me on this one.
Helen Reddy, All-Time Greatest Hits
If you are not a child of the 70′s…. you won’t get it… just pass on by this one. But, be warned, my kids listened to this album and FELL IN LOVE! They loved the songs with easy to remember lyrics and sing it SO LOUD!
Pat Benatar, Greatest Hits
This is an oldie, but GOODIE! Just listening to Wuthering Heightsmade me decide to re-read the book. I love love love Ms. Benatar… and, it’s a hit with the tweens!
Nelly Furtado, Loose
In God’s Hands is a hauntingly beautiful song. Of course, you get all the hot hits on here as well. But, that song… oh… gets me! AND… All Good Things Come To An End is fantastic!
Mary J. Blige, Growing Pains
Just Fine is worth the album itself! If you work out… that song is a MUST for the treadmill.
Tori Amos, The Piano
Since I love every single album just like they were my children… I can’t recommend just one. So, The Piano offers up everything you need up through 2006! GO FOR IT! ($59.98 for entire box set)
Stevie Nicks, The Other Side of the Mirror
Like Pat Benatar and Tori Amos, it’s tough to recommend just one… If you are looking for a good “greatest hits” from her, Timespace is a great album. Vintage Stevie lovers can reminisce by listening to this one or Bella Donna. It takes you back and keeps you there! ($10.99)
